-
编码方法,你掌握了吗
常言道:"熟读唐诗三百首,不会作诗也会吟。"编码也是同样的道理,编码的第一步就是模仿,简单地说就是"抄代码"——复制粘贴代码。复制粘贴代码是一门艺术,用好了编码会事半功倍。但是,没有检验过的东西,终究是不可全信的。当看到需要的代码时,在复制粘贴前,我们都需要仔细研读、认真思考、详细甄别……很多东西,都是仁者见仁、智者见智的东西,适合别的场景但不一定适合你的场景。作为一名合格的程序员,切不可一味地"拿来主义"。 1.为什么要复制粘贴代码 复制粘贴现有代码,可以节省开发时间; 复制粘贴稳定代码,可以降低系统故障风险; 复制粘贴网络代码,可以把别人的成果化为己用。 2.复制粘贴代码带来问题 你对复制的代码理解程度是多少?实现逻辑是否合理?能不能稳定运行?存在多少潜在的Bug? 这个代码在项目中已经复制粘贴了多少次?根据“三则重构”原则,你是否需要对这些相同代码进行重构? 代
发表于 2023-05-23 17:14:48 28次浏览
-
Java编程的学习技巧
随着互联网时代的发展,软件开发行业热度不断飙升,企业对软件开发人才需求量也与日俱增,尤以Java工程师为首,这也是一直以来Java培训日趋火热的原因。Java工程师薪资高、待遇好,越来越多的人想转行Java软件开发,那么今天小编就和大家说说学Java编程的几个学习技巧,希望可以帮助到大家: 确定学习Java的决心 万事开头难,其实对于编程来说,开头并不是那么难,因为开始学习编程的小伙伴基本上都有兴趣点,有一腔热血挺过入门问题不大,学习编程只靠一腔热血还是不够的,贵在坚持,很多人都是倒在坚持的路上,半途而废,学习编程其实也没啥好的捷径就是先搞懂理论,然后开始不停的练习实践,反反复复,其实这个过程都知道要经历多少个循环和反复,慢慢的一些基本的概念随着时间的推移都成了你的基本功,在此基础上继续提升自己的能力水平就会显得游刃有余,没有坚持别的都是空话。 选择合适的入门教材 在网上搜过资
发表于 2023-05-23 17:11:53 76次浏览
-
循序渐进学习oracle的步骤
循序渐进学习oracle 1.需要了解数据库原理基本知识,明白行、列概念,有关系型数据库知识。 2.有环境学习数据库,如自己XP上安装,或公司的小型机,或PC,linux,solaris, AIX,或hp-unix等等环境。 3.开始学习sql基础。DML,DDL,DCL,等等多加练习。先过sql这一关。 4.安装oracle,9i以上版本吧,10g也可以,但资料上,学习中遇到问题解决方面有一定的难度,因为用的人还不是最多的。($oracle_base,$oracle_home,SID)这三个概念一定要清楚。 5.开始学习oracle了,基础的启动关闭(才开始只要会startup,和shutdownimmediate就可以了,),再学习SQLplus(设定环境变量,设定格式),同时学习iSQL*PLUS(这个要事先启动httpserver服务)。OK,你的基
发表于 2023-05-23 17:01:38 44次浏览
-
谈一谈Oracle的学习方法
1.了解Oracle的组成,掌握Oracle由哪些文件组成,每个文件有什么作用。 比如:密码文件,控制文件,redolog,数据文件,alertlog,SGA组成,PGA组成。 只有了解了这些定义,和他们的作用之后,才能在大脑中对Oracle形成一个框架。这个很重要,如果说玩了几年的Oracle,都没有这个框架,那么就是杯具,因为还没有入门。这个框架就是Oracle的入门标准之一。 2.掌握Oracle的常用技术 Oracle的常用技术就那么多,我罗列出来: 1)windows/linux/Unix平台下的安装,卸载。 2)冷备与冷备的还原 3)逻辑备份与还原 4)RMAN备份与还原 5)数据搬迁:可用逻辑备份或者RMAN来。 6)添加表空间 7)高可用之DataGuard安装与维护 8)高可用之RAC安装
发表于 2023-05-23 17:00:12 35次浏览
-
误删除 Oracle 数据库数据的恢复方法
学习数据库时,我们只是以学习的态度,考虑如何使用数据库命令语句,并未想过工作中,如果误操作一下,都可能导致无可挽回的损失。 今天主要以oracle数据库为例,介绍关于表中数据删除的解决办法。(不考虑全库备份和利用归档日志) 删除表中数据有三种方法: delete(删除一条记录) drop或truncate删除表格中数据 1.delete误删除的解决方法 原理: 利用oracle提供的闪回方法,如果在删除数据后还没做大量的操作(只要保证被删除数据的块没被覆写),就可以利用闪回方式直接找回删除的数据。 具体步骤为: 确定删除数据的时间(在删除数据之前的时间就行,不过最好是删除数据的时间点) 用以下语句找出删除的数据:selectfrom表名asoftimestampto_timestamp('删除时间点','yyyy-mm-ddh
发表于 2023-05-23 16:58:18 60次浏览